Transaction dbfcbd4b2e19426a342000126ecbb61ba3430c5cb18adfd45889b2f51d07199e
1 Input
1 Output
-
dbfcbd4b2e19426a342000126ecbb61ba3430c5cb18adfd45889b2f51d07199e:0
- value
- 73547
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a526791cfdbda96938799112395c35eef108838 OP_EQUAL
- address
- 3QWba55etiQvd4Znoa7eU1ZKYrQHN6Hfiq